Once upon a time, in a magical forest, there lived a unicorn named Karen. She had a special power – the power of empathy. Karen could understand and share the feelings of others.
Karen loved to help her friends. One day, she noticed that her friend Ellie the elephant was feeling sad. Ellie had lost her favorite toy. Karen used her empathy to understand how Ellie felt and decided to help her find it.
Karen and Ellie searched high and low for the toy. They looked behind trees, under rocks, and even in a nearby pond. Finally, Karen spotted the toy stuck between two branches. She gently reached for it and gave it back to Ellie.
Karen's next mission was to help Leo the lion, who was feeling angry because he had lost a race. Karen listened to Leo's frustrations and told him that losing doesn't define him. She encouraged him to try again and not give up.
Karen's empathy made the forest a happier place. One day, she noticed a little bird named Bella feeling lonely. Bella had lost her flock during a storm. Karen used her magic to send out a signal, and soon, Bella's flock found her. Bella was overjoyed to be reunited with her family.
As time went on, Karen's empathy continued to touch the lives of everyone in the magical forest. She helped rabbits who were scared of thunderstorms, squirrels who were shy, and even frogs who were feeling homesick. Karen showed them all that they were not alone.
One day, a wizard visited the magical forest. He had heard about Karen's incredible power of empathy and wanted to learn from her. Karen taught the wizard how to listen, understand, and share in the feelings of others.
The news of Karen's empathy spread far and wide. Animals and even humans from neighboring villages came to the forest to meet her. Karen was happy to help them all, and her empathy made the world a better place.
Karen's story teaches us the importance of empathy. By understanding and sharing in the feelings of others, we can make a positive impact on their lives. So always remember, be like Karen the Empathy Unicorn!
